TL* THE CONTACT OWNS A 2013 MERCEDES BENZ GLK 350. THE CONTACT STATED THAT WHILE DRIVING APPROXIMATELY 65 MPH, THE CONTACT HEARD A LOUD ABNORMAL NOISE AS THE VEHICLE SUN ROOF SHATTERED INTO SMALL PIECES. THE VEHICLE WAS MANEUVERED TO THE SIDE OF THE ROAD FOR THE CONTACT TO OBSERVE THE FAILURE. THE VEHICLE WAS NOT TAKEN TO A DEALER FOR DIAGNOSIS OR REPAIRS. THE MANUFACTURER WAS MADE AWARE OF THE PROBLEM. THE APPROXIMATE FAILURE MILEAGE WAS 9,400.
